I think there is a misunderstanding: SunSDR2-software does not allow a real SO2R/duplex yet. That is supposed to come in V3. Simultaneous transmit is not ready yet.
I have experienced with dxlog in SO2R-mode with 2 keyboards to control both rx, each one as a separate radio. COM-connection is done for both RX like described in UMA, it makes both rx compatible as separate radios in dxlog. Remember that COM is a pair, so COM5 in the sdr will be COM6 in dxlog. CW/keying is done via DTR/RTS. When I want to transmit on the 2nd radio/rx I swap the radios with CTRL-S (or shortcut F10), grab the multi and swap back to the 1st radio/rx for CQ. That's it. All radio-control is done via E-Coder.
Still it is actually more like SO2V but without dunestar, extra so2r-controller, microham-boxes etc. I am sure that the real SO2R will come, but filters are needed.
I love SunSDR with its integrated skimmer, that makes it very easy. SDC is a great software, but I use it only used for skimmer and its / cluster-integration for dxlog. COM-spider is not needed for this constellation.
